Autonomy Engineer III
The Hexagon A&P’s Autonomous Systems Team is responsible for developing and deploying software to enable our customers to fully utilize their autonomous vehicle’s hardware. We are a collaborative team of driven engineers with a mission to simplify and advance vehicle technology to empower our customers to unleash autonomy; driving improved efficiency, productivity, quality, and safety.
As a Autonomy Engineer III at AutonomouStuff, you will work with the latest technology while solving interesting and challenging problems in multiple industries. You will be responsible for a wide variety of tasks such as assisting in by-wire design, creating and deploying vehicle control strategies, creating simulation scenarios, coordinating with test engineering, debugging, and on-vehicle testing and tuning.

Responsibilities
As Autonomy Engineer III, you will:
  • Develop autonomous vehicles for mining haulage vehicles
  • Be a key engineer in developing, integrating, and delivering a full solution that seamlessly integrates Hexagon technologies, by-wire, autonomy, and site systems
  • Coordinate and collaborate closely with local development teams and remote development teams in the United States and Canada
  • Take occasional trips to customer mine site, FIFO, for on-vehicle deployment, testing, and tuning of controls and autonomy
  • Design control strategies and algorithms for complex vehicle systems
  • Participate in design and gate reviews
  • Assist with autonomous vehicle application development using MATLAB, Simulink, and C++
  • Demonstrate solutions by developing documentation, flowcharts, and diagrams to support problem analysis
  • Assist with controls algorithm integration into our proprietary autonomy stack
  • Contribute to customer documentation and training material for various software applications
  • Create test instructions
  • Support field testing and troubleshooting of products by field technicians
  • Perform regular final checks of on-vehicle testing of software releases, analysis of vehicle control behavior
  • Occasional on-vehicle software/hardware integration, debugging, and troubleshooting
  • Minimal international travel may be required
Qualifications
Must Have:
  • Bachelor’s or Master’s Degree in an engineering discipline
  • 5-8+ years experience of relevant experience
  • Production autonomous deployment experience
  • Understanding of C++ software development and automatic code generation for deployment to an embedded Linux environment
  • Professional, adaptable to fast changing requirements
  • Experience with DDS or equivalent pub/sub communications
